A Different Kind of University

Nepal Communiversity is an initiative that originated at King’s College and has grown into an independent, registered not-for-profit organization since 2023. Our mission is to bring academia, industry, state and community together to co-create learning programs, ranging from fellowships to a master’s degree where students engage deeply with local knowledge systems, develop personal and social agency, and contribute meaningfully to the communities they serve. Central to our approach is cultivating entrepreneurship and social innovation, empowering learners to design and lead transformative solutions within their local context

Our Model of Innovation

At Nepal Communiversity, the Quadruple Helix model brings together academia, industry, government, and communities as equal partners in learning. Through community immersion, reflection, and collaboration, students develop holistic skills while co-creating real-world solutions and meaningful impact.

A Journey Across Nepal

From idea to practice, growing through communities and lived experience.

5 Dec

2018

A small group of educators from King’s College came together to reimagine higher education in Nepal.
2018

Sep

2021

Concept paper developed, shaped by community, academia, and industry insights.
2021

Summer

2023

Communiversity conceptualized as an Entrepreneurship University.

2023

Winter

2024

Explored “What makes a community?” through storytelling-led immersion in culture, language, digital narratives, and everyday life.
2024

Summer

2025

Social Innovation Fellowship launched—Himal, Pahad, Madhes learning model (pilot).
2025

Now

2026

Master’s in Social Innovation & Entrepreneurship.
